York County, PA – Multi-Vehicle Crash on I-83 South Causes Morning Delays

Multi-Vehicle Crash on I-83

York County, PA (December 8, 2025) – A multi-vehicle crash caused significant disruptions to the morning commute on Interstate 83 southbound in York County on Monday morning.

The collision occurred around 8:05 a.m. on I-83 southbound at Exit 19B to Market Street. The incident required a lane restriction, forcing vehicles to maneuver around the scene, leading to considerable delays during the morning rush hour.

While the severity of the crash and the status of any injuries were not immediately released, the crash was serious enough to require an emergency response and temporary lane closure. The roadway was eventually cleared and reopened.

Understanding Liability and Negligence in I-83 Multi-Vehicle Crashes

Multi-vehicle crashes on high-speed interstate highways like I-83 are complex legal events because liability is often shared among multiple drivers in a chain reaction. While the initial driver who caused the wreck is primarily at fault, subsequent drivers may also be held liable if they were following too closely or driving distracted, thereby failing to stop in time to avoid the collision.
